Rugged LNG Loading Arms for Marine Applications
In the maritime sector, seamlessly transferring liquefied natural gas (LNG) between vessels and shore facilities is crucial. Heavy-duty LNG loading arm systems are specifically engineered to guarantee safe and reliable marine transfers of this volatile commodity. These sophisticated systems feature durable components designed to withstand the harsh environmental conditions prevalent in port environments. They incorporate multiple layers of security protocols, including automatic shut-off mechanisms and secondary systems, to mitigate the risk of spills or leaks.
- Essential elements of a heavy-duty LNG loading arm system include:
- An articulated arm structure
- Instrumentation for flow regulation
- Redundant safety features
Furthermore, these systems often integrate intelligent controls to streamline the loading process, enhancing operational efficiency and reducing manual intervention. Concisely, heavy-duty LNG loading arm Loading arm systems play a vital role in ensuring safe and streamlined LNG transfers within the maritime industry.

Constructing Reliable Loading Arms for LPG and LNG Industries
Loading arms play a essential role in the safe and efficient handling of liquefied petroleum gas (LPG) and liquefied natural gas (LNG). These specialized systems must be heavily designed to withstand the rigors of daily operations, including fluctuating pressures. A reliable loading arm ensures minimal dispersion during transfer, protecting both personnel and the environment.
When developing loading arms for LPG and LNG sectors, several key considerations must be evaluated. These include the exact properties of the gas being transported, the amount to be shifted, and the environmental conditions at the loading facility.
Components must be carefully chosen based on their corrosion resistance, durability, and suitability with the specific gas. A well-designed loading arm should also incorporate security features such as flow monitoring systems, emergency disconnection valves, and stable grounding methods.
Adherence to industry guidelines, such as those set by the International Organization for Standardization (ISO), is essential for ensuring that loading arms meet the highest standards of safety and efficiency.
